Output 32af78172ef83838ec7060d825bbee29615d91fd56fcc9fe07815258ff2459ec:22

value
181038964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9438385abb91584576834dfd72c50be3c332661 OP_EQUAL
address
3QR14FKWt88giBAeTgLYHjnbnarmXvmVz5
transaction
32af78172ef83838ec7060d825bbee29615d91fd56fcc9fe07815258ff2459ec
spent
true